Understanding Different Types of Christmas Parties
Before we dive into specific outfit ideas, it’s essential to recognize the various types of Christmas parties you might attend:
- Casual Gatherings: These are typically informal events with friends or family.
- Office Parties: Professional yet festive, these parties often require a balance between fun and business attire.
- Formal Celebrations: These events, such as galas or charity balls, call for elegant evening wear.
- Themed Parties: These can range from ugly sweater parties to glamorous winter wonderland themes.
Step-by-Step Guide to Choosing Your Christmas Party Attire
Step 1: Assess the Invitation
The first step in selecting your Christmas party attire is to carefully review the invitation. It often provides vital clues about the dress code:
- Casual: Opt for comfortable yet stylish outfits, such as a nice sweater and jeans.
- Business Casual: Consider tailored trousers with a festive blouse or a blazer over a chic dress.
- Formal: Look for long gowns or tuxedos, and don’t forget elegant accessories.
- Themed: Get creative! Incorporate elements that reflect the theme while still looking put-together.
Step 2: Choose Your Color Palette
Colors play a significant role in festive fashion. Traditional Christmas colors like red, green, gold, and silver are always a safe bet. However, feel free to explore other options, such as:
- Metallics: Shimmering fabrics can add a touch of glamour.
- Rich Jewel Tones: Colors like emerald green, deep blue, and burgundy can be both festive and sophisticated.
- Pastels: For a more modern twist, consider soft pinks or icy blues.
Step 3: Consider the Fabric and Fit
The fabric you choose can significantly impact your comfort level throughout the evening. Here are some popular materials:
- Velvet: Luxurious and perfect for winter.
- Silk: A classic choice for a refined look.
- Knits: Ideal for casual gatherings, providing warmth and comfort.
Moreover, ensure the fit is flattering. Avoid overly tight or baggy clothes, as both can detract from your overall appearance.
Step 4: Accessorize Wisely
Accessories can elevate your Christmas party attire significantly. Here are some tips:
- Jewelry: Choose bold pieces for formal events or delicate items for a casual look.
- Footwear: Select comfortable yet stylish shoes; consider heels for formal events and boots for casual gatherings.
- Bags: A chic clutch can add sophistication, while a larger bag may be necessary for casual outings.
Step 5: Don’t Forget About Outerwear
If you’re in a colder climate, your outerwear is just as important as your outfit. Consider the following:
- Tailored Coats: A well-fitted coat can enhance any outfit.
- Wraps or Shawls: Perfect for added warmth and style.
- Festive Scarves: A colorful scarf can add a fun touch to your look.
Troubleshooting Common Christmas Party Attire Issues
Even with careful planning, wardrobe malfunctions and outfit dilemmas can occur. Here are some common issues and how to resolve them:
Issue 1: Inappropriate Attire
If you realize your outfit doesn’t match the event’s dress code:
- Layer Up: Add a blazer or dress coat if you’re underdressed.
- Accessorize: Elevate your look with statement jewelry or shoes.
Issue 2: Discomfort
If your outfit feels uncomfortable:
- Adjust Fit: Use fashion tape to secure slipping straps or adjust hemlines.
- Choose Comfortable Shoes: If heels are painful, consider stylish flats as an alternative.
Issue 3: Stains or Damage
In the unfortunate event of a spill or snag:
- Quick Fix: Keep a stain remover pen handy for minor spills.
- Stay Calm: If it’s a larger issue, excuse yourself to the restroom for a quick fix.
